Ellen Rim ey (separate estate), £2 2s balance due for photographic services. , CLAIM FOR FURNITURE.
'Alexander Wilson M'Karlane (Ifinlield), sheep fanner, last week succeeded in a. claim lor the .return ot furniture held -by his cx-wifo, Mary 'Vllcwvn Parkcs M'Farlanc. rhe parties had been divorced. An order was then made for the delivery ot the goods within a week. , , , Mr A. C. Hanlon said the goods had not been returned, and he accordingly n;kcd for an order. Mr W. In Moore (lor defendant) said that, as frequently happened in such cases, his client would not listen to him last week, and she had not implied' to his telegram urging her to consent to the order. In making on order lor the return of the articles, the Magistrate said that it might bring defendant to hei Se Mr S Hanlon asked that only nominal damages for retention be made, so that he could apply for a warrant. Damages were fixed at L--
